How Common Is The Last Name Oburumu? popularity and diffusion
Oburumu is the 3,373,373rd most commonly occurring last name globally, held by around 1 in 214,339,586 people. The surname Oburumu occurs predominantly in Africa, where 97 percent of Oburumu are found; 97 percent are found in West Africa and 97 percent are found in Atlantic-Niger Africa.
This last name is most frequently held in Nigeria, where it is held by 33 people, or 1 in 5,367,962. In Nigeria Oburumu is mostly concentrated in: Delta, where 97 percent live and Rivers, where 3 percent live. Apart from Nigeria this surname exists in one country. It is also found in The United States, where 3 percent live.
